Vodafone considers selling its assets in China, France and Egypt?

June 1, 2010 by Dusan Belic - Leave a Comment

It seems Vodafone is looking into selling its minority interests in operators in China and France. In China, UK’s group holds 3.2% of China Mobile, which [Vodafone’s share] is now worth nearly $6 billion. As for France, Voda owns 44% of SFR (the majority owner is Vivendi).
